I have a log file of the following sort:

 vendor productId clusterId
A        1         1
B        2         1
A        3         1
C        4         4
D        8         8
D        9         8
D        10       10

Now I would like to select those vendors who have a least one productId which is contained in a cluster of size at least k. The cluster size corresponds to the number of rows with the same clusterId.

So, in the example above, companies A and B both appear in a cluster of size 3, D in a cluster of size 2 and company C in a cluster of size 1.

In SQL I would solve this using sub-queries, but I am not sure how to tackle this in splunk.

Try this (adjust where clause per your need)

your current search giving above output with fields vendor productId clusterId
| eventstats count as clusterSize by clusterId
| where clusterSize>k | stats count as productsCount by vendor
